Inexorable Quote by Warren G. Harding
“We must proceed with a full realization that no statute enacted by man can repeal the inexorable laws of nature.”
About This Quote
Source Speech: Inaugural Address, Warren G. Harding, 1921
Human law cannot override natural law; nature’s principles are immutable and supreme.
In simple terms: Nature’s rules cannot be changed by human laws.
